The most successful album of Pearl Jam’s career, ‘Ten’ catapulted the Seattle band into the public consciousness, and along with Nirvana’s ‘Nevermind’ it helped to define the grunge movement. However, unlike Nirvana, who had their roots in punk, Pearl Jam drew heavily on 70s rock influences, and used singer Eddie Vedder’s powerful voice to full effect on songs from such as ‘Alive’, ‘Even Flow’ and ‘Jeremy’, all of which were hit singles. Ten, is by far their most successful album selling in excess of 10 million sales.

Epic Records are reissuing this classic rock album, as a deluxe double LP package.

“The band loved the original mix of Ten, but were also interested in what it would sound like if I were to deconstruct and remix it,” says producer Brendan O’Brien. “The original Ten sound is what millions of people bought, dug and loved, so I was initially hesitant to mess around with that. After years of persistent nudging from the band, I was able to wrap my head around the idea of offering it as a companion piece to the original giving a fresh take on it, a more direct sound”. Pearl Jam bassist Jeff Ament, who served as the art director for the original Ten packaging, reprised his role for the reissues collaborating with designer, Andy Fischer, of Cameron Crowe’s Vinyl Films (Into the Wild soundtrack LP, Vanilla Sky soundtrack LP, Harold and Maude anniversary edition soundtrack LP).

“The goal was to assemble the ultimate fan-piece,” explains Fischer. “Something Pearl Jam lovers could pore over as they experience an indelible record all over again, in an entirely new way.”

“The original concept was about really being together as a group and entering into the world of music as a true band…a sort of all-for-one deal”, says Jeff Ament. “There were some elements of the original Ten artwork that didn’t turn out the way we had hoped, due to time constraints. With this reissue, we’ve been able to take our time and invest resources into making the design the way we had originally intended”. In the process of digging through his archives for this project, Ament came across an old cassette marked “Momma-Son” the fabled original Pearl Jam demo tape featuring the first recorded versions of “Alive,” “Once” and “Footsteps.” Ament and guitarists Stone Gossard and Mike McCready had recorded instrumental tracks of these songs to help solicit a singer for their newly formed band. Mutual friend and then Red Hot Chili Peppers drummer Jack Irons suggested they send the tape down to San Diego surfer and little-known singer Eddie Vedder.
